Description
For modpack authors to manage a configurable list to give starter items to players when they first join worlds, allows configurating messages to send to players when they first join a world, and messages for subsequent joins, and even running commands on each server startup (especially useful for setting gamerules, /setworldspawn, or things such as disabling Terralith Traveler's Map due to Watchdog timeout issues related to it).
Fully configurable, see below!
Features
- Toggle to clear inventory items of players when they first join worlds, before giving them the Starter Items. This can even be used to just completely clear player inventory items
- Configurable Starter Items, supporting NBT data for the items (if you need help with this, let me know!)
- First Join Messages
- Welcome Messages, for when player joins after the first join
- Commands to run on each Server Startup, supports all commands available to the game
Config
Add starter items, firstJoinMessages, welcomeMessages, and serverStartCommands to config/starteritems.json5
 . See https://github.com/spoorn/StarterItems/blob/main/config-documentation.json5 or the config file for examples.
Example:
Dependencies
This mod requires:
- Fabric API - https://modrinth.com/mod/fabric-api
Need a Server?
90% of ad revenue goes to creators
Support creators and Modrinth ad-free with Modrinth+